Album Review
Ragnar of Ravensfjord
Reviewed 2010-11-15
MASSIVE DOOM-HEAVY PSYCH METAL from Sweden with the unholy vocals of Tommie Eriksson. Eriksson comes off like the diabolical offspring of Killdozer’s Michael Gerald, Celtic Frost/Triptykon’s Tom G. Warrior and even Cirith Ungol’s Tim Baker. Yes, they play a lotta wah-wah but “stoner rock/metal” this is NOT! 100% BAD TRIP DOOM…but it can be good for you if you’re a true riff worshipper and if you’ve been clued into Resonaut, Electric Wizard, and Ramesses.

(((((((1))))))) An opening riff sweet as the sound that Lord Iommi first gave us. Slowly, steadily and heavily crushes you with the familiar and unfamiliar – downtuned, bombastic rhythms consecrated with the wicked echoing roar of Mr. Eriksson.

((((((2)))))) Swampy, wah-wah, trunding through a dark-lit castle and vocals straight from outta hell.
